ՁקPPQ8%1^p8]EfYARBpLDx86_64-linux-gnu'!_G %  !_ G % %  % gwMM !aa= .MM=  % g#!_w  !+_+5ۉ5 a a! a# a%a'#a)%)gG#a+%+gG%-%/EA %1%3E?%5%7E?'9a;%;w55GGK 1=)=) $K-   aAa)#gGaCaE%Ew =9'c'=??؏ =! g{%I#gw! %M!))//mGG3 M)  !#g%Qg˧w!%)S!U!!!cOO_ C+ # !#g5%Ygw!%)[!]WW =%  ! % # g5%Yg%_%agG }%cgGw!%23)[!i!k!WW]]1 cI #%Ig%og%q%q%s%uG%w%w%y%{G%}w!'' ?)S!U!!!!U!!!!!yymmb eSCC #gw! %A) = 1 l 1 {'!G{  ͋ %}!G%g {s!G{k# g ge!G Ag%gG}!G# g g5e#G{1{!G{ gG}!G Ag%ggG w  !!""##$$$%%&&!!(())**++,,,+...0023!            )H%IJKLMN'__'_!'_'!{{u{{#!!!!!!)!!!!!!!!)!!!!!!!!!!   13 jo0=!k %I# % 9gwGHHIIJ!%!+)99m !GJ M)   #gw! %)) 5 ) ) %  gk/#%gGe%G# gw!we'G# gw!!!    %b%5AA))3U3U)'Wcc!!)))))ss 1 k+!W}   }σ % Ӆ% %Յ%g % %   5%g%gG %  %Ig) % % %IgG  % % gw! 39#%nop!!!!!!! +k++   %   g}# % %gG }_# % %I] } Ig-% I] } Ig-%+ /gGw!]%b!)!!!))) kQ11ˡw$$$$   !yi I$5$KiI ??ˡw,,,,   !{k Y,9,OkK ??#!_+w  ucmGcK 99#!_-w  q_C_G 99 % Y# % %gwy) EE;Io;# #%)gG''%)%CgG#%)gw   )!)/s/E??iE)+ #%)gG''%)%EgG#%)gw   )!)/q/C??C'- n^$3`; 5 m P ' SEG/usr/lib/ruby/2.7.0/securerandom.rbE
)E+E%GOW]mEAEZEaEzE0E9Esingleton classErandom_bytesCEhexEH*E base64Em0Eurlsafe_base64E+/E-_E=E uuidE NnnnnN ~ E9%08x-%04x-%04x-%04x-%04x%08xEgen_randomE choosePEEalphanumericE bytesEopensslE%gen_random_opensslE%gen_random_urandomE!No random deviceEcUnexpected partial read from random device: only E for E bytesEblock in chooseE'block in gen_randomE)rescue in gen_randomESecureRandomE RandomEFormatterE extendE MutexE@rng_chooserEsingletonclassEnewEALPHANUMERICEprivateEnE to_intE unpackE[]E packEpaddingEsEtr!Edelete!EaryE&E|E[]=E%E sourceE sizeEmE limitE resultErsEisE*E+E<=EdupErandom_numberE digitsE lengthE-E timesEvalues_atE joinE<<E